Beto is struggling to provide the firepower needed for Everton
Beto has struggled to provide consistent goals for Everton since he joined the club, as he hasn’t provided the prolific performances that the team needs.
That has continued under David Moyes this season, as Beto has scored just once in the Premier League, despite featuring in all seven of Everton’s games.
Moyes admitted his disappointment in Beto during the summer, revealing that he had to speak to him privately to try and get more out of his performances.

Everton are concerned that they need another striker, and the club is preparing to make moves in the January transfer window to fill this void.
Whether Beto would be departing Everton to make way for a new player is unclear at this point, but the club is looking at potential replacements for him.
